Recent actions by GameStop in the cryptocurrency space have drawn the attention of investors and analysts following the announcement of a $1.75 billion convertible debt offering.
Debt Offering of $1.75 Billion
GameStop announced the issuance of convertible senior notes worth $1.75 billion, which led to a 5% drop in the company's shares during regular trading and an additional 11% in after-hours trading. Investors expressed concerns about possible dilution related to the company's expanding cryptocurrency plans.
Bitcoin Acquisition
The company acquired 4,710 Bitcoin, valued at approximately $507 million at current prices. These assets are part of GameStop’s treasury reserve strategy, focusing on asset stabilization.
